Planning for long-term results requires assets that do not become obsolete. Raster images (pixels) degrade when enlarged, forcing costly redesigns as a business expands its physical presence. In contrast, a High Mountain icon Logo vector illustration design Template is future-proof. It scales infinitely because it is built on mathematical paths rather than fixed grids. This scalability supports aggressive growth strategies. A startup can launch with a website favicon and, five years later, apply the same file to a fleet of vehicles or a headquarters signage package without needing to recreate the artwork. This consistency reinforces brand recall, a critical component of customer experience and market positioning.

Risk Mitigation and Intentional Implementation

While the advantages are clear, relying on a High Mountain icon Logo vector illustration design Template without a clear strategic framework carries risks. The primary danger is genericism. Because mountain icons are popular, there is a temptation to select a template that looks "good" but says nothing specific about the brand. If every competitor in a sector uses a similar triangular peak, the brand loses its distinctiveness. To mitigate this, leaders must approach the template as a starting point, not a final destination. Customization is key. Adjusting the angle of the peak, combining it with unique typography, or integrating abstract elements can transform a standard template into a proprietary asset.

Furthermore, using such assets without understanding the technical requirements can lead to execution errors. A common mistake is embedding a vector file into a platform that does not support it, or exporting it incorrectly to a raster format too early in the process. Professionals must ensure that the master vector file is archived securely and that only appropriate derivatives are distributed to vendors. This discipline protects the brand's visual equity. It also ensures that the investment in a high-quality template yields the expected return in terms of quality and longevity.

Decision-Making Framework for Adoption

When evaluating whether a High Mountain Icon Logo Vector is the right fit, consider the following decision matrix. First, assess the brand narrative: Does the concept of elevation, challenge, or nature resonate with the core value proposition? Second, audit the current visual ecosystem: Will this icon complement existing assets or clash with them? Third, project future needs: Will the brand expand into physical products or large-scale advertising where vector scalability is non-negotiable?

If the answers align, the next step is sourcing. Not all templates are created equal. Look for files that offer clean geometry, logical layering, and comprehensive format options (such as AI, EPS, SVG, and PDF). Avoid templates with unnecessary effects or complex gradients that may not reproduce well in single-color applications like stamps or faxes. The goal is to find a balance between artistic flair and functional robustness. A thoughtful selection process here prevents costly revisions down the line.

  1. Define the Core Message: Determine exactly what the mountain symbolizes for your specific audience.
  2. Analyze Competitors: Ensure your chosen variation distinguishes you from others in the niche.
  3. Test Versatility: Mock up the logo in black and white, small sizes, and reversed colors before finalizing.
  4. Secure the Source: Obtain the editable source files to maintain full ownership and control.
  5. Document Usage: Create simple guidelines for your team on how and when to use the icon.
